Choosing Your Direct Supplier: 5 Essential Checks
- Certifications (UL, CE, UN38.3)
- Customization capabilities
- After-sales support scope
- Scalable production capacity
- Export documentation expertise

FAQ: Direct Manufacturer Procurement
Q: How long does custom mobile unit production take?
A: Standard models ship in 2-3 weeks; customized solutions require 5-8 weeks depending on complexity.
Q: What's the minimum order quantity?
A: Most manufacturers accept MOQs of 5-10 units for standard configurations.
